North Dakota among top 5 states for population growth from 2010 to 2020
North Dakota s population grew by 106,503 from 2010 to 2020, according to census figures, ranking it in the top five in percentage gains. North Dakota s official population as of 2020 was 779,094. Written By: Patrick Springer | ×

FARGO North Dakota’s population soared by more than 100,000 from 2010 to 2020 the fastest population growth the state has seen in more than a century.
Census figures released on Monday, April 26, indicate North Dakota has a population of 779,094. That’s 106,503 more than the 2010 census count, or an increase of 15.8%, ranking the state in the top five in terms of percentage population growth.
